That's what therapy has been like for me too. Its like someone more knowledgeble who gives me advice about my problems. So far I have done c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T). Its all about changing your thoughts in order to change your behavior. I feel like it teaches a positive and empowering way of thinking. I've had a lot of bad things happen in the last few years, but I feel this way of thinking has helped me turn them into positives. I used to have very negative thoughts about myself, like: 'I'm a loser', 'nothing will ever get better for me', ect. Its really hard to get out of the habit of thinking that way, but I'm living proof that it can happen. I would highly encourage giving it a try. What have you got to lose?
